Searched refs:LinkageName (Results 1 - 21 of 21) sorted by relevance

/external/llvm/tools/llvm-pdbdump/
H A DExternalSymbolDumper.cpp29 std::string LinkageName = Symbol.getName(); local
30 if (Printer.IsSymbolExcluded(LinkageName))
39 WithColor(Printer, PDB_ColorItem::Identifier).get() << LinkageName;
/external/llvm/tools/llvm-symbolizer/
H A Dllvm-symbolizer.cpp43 "functions", cl::init(FunctionNameKind::LinkageName),
48 clEnumValN(FunctionNameKind::LinkageName, "linkage",
/external/llvm/include/llvm/IR/
H A DDIBuilder.h438 /// \param LinkageName Mangled name of the variable.
447 StringRef LinkageName, DIFile *File,
456 D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*File,
509 /// \param LinkageName Mangled function name.
521 StringRef LinkageName, DIFile *File,
532 DIScope *Scope, StringRef Name, StringRef LinkageName, DIFile *File,
541 StringRef LinkageName, DIFile *File,
553 /// \param LinkageName Mangled function name.
568 createMethod(DIScope *Scope, StringRef Name, StringRef LinkageName,
H A DDebugInfoMetadata.h1246 StringRef LinkageName, DIFile *File, unsigned Line,
1254 getCanonicalMDString(Context, LinkageName), File, Line, Type,
1262 MDString *LinkageName, Metadata *File, unsigned Line, Metadata *Type,
1279 (DIScopeRef Scope, StringRef Name, StringRef LinkageName,
1287 (Scope, Name, LinkageName, File, Line, Type, IsLocalToUnit,
1293 (Metadata * Scope, MDString *Name, MDString *LinkageName, Metadata *File,
1299 (Scope, Name, LinkageName, File, Line, Type, IsLocalToUnit, IsDefinition,
1784 StringRef LinkageName, DIFile *File, unsigned Line, DITypeRef Type,
1789 getCanonicalMDString(Context, LinkageName), File, Line, Type,
1796 MDString *LinkageName, Metadat
1245 getImpl(LLVMContext &Context, DIScopeRef Scope, StringRef Name, StringRef LinkageName, DIFile *File, unsigned Line, DISubroutineType *Type, bool IsLocalToUnit, bool IsDefinition, unsigned ScopeLine, DITypeRef ContainingType, unsigned Virtuality, unsigned VirtualIndex, unsigned Flags, bool IsOptimized, DITemplateParameterArray TemplateParams, DISubprogram *Declaration, DILocalVariableArray Variables, StorageType Storage, bool ShouldCreate = true) argument
1783 getImpl(LLVMContext &Context, DIScope *Scope, StringRef Name, StringRef LinkageName, DIFile *File, unsigned Line, DITypeRef Type, bool IsLocalToUnit, bool IsDefinition, Constant *Variable, DIDerivedType *StaticDataMemberDeclaration, StorageType Storage, bool ShouldCreate = true) argument
[all...]
/external/llvm/lib/IR/
H A DLLVMContextImpl.h464 StringRef LinkageName; member in struct:llvm::MDNodeKeyImpl
480 MDNodeKeyImpl(Metadata *Scope, StringRef Name, StringRef LinkageName, argument
487 : Scope(Scope), Name(Name), LinkageName(LinkageName), File(File),
496 LinkageName(N->getLinkageName()), File(N->getRawFile()),
507 LinkageName == RHS->getLinkageName() && File == RHS->getRawFile() &&
521 return hash_combine(Scope, Name, LinkageName, File, Line, Type,
655 StringRef LinkageName; member in struct:llvm::MDNodeKeyImpl
664 MDNodeKeyImpl(Metadata *Scope, StringRef Name, StringRef LinkageName, argument
668 : Scope(Scope), Name(Name), LinkageName(LinkageNam
[all...]
H A DDIBuilder.cpp580 D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*F,
586 Name, LinkageName, F, LineNumber,
594 D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*F,
600 VMContext, cast_or_null<DIScope>(Context), Name, LinkageName, F,
665 DIScopeRef Context, StringRef Name, StringRef LinkageName, DIFile *File,
672 return createFunction(Context.resolve(EmptyMap), Name, LinkageName, File,
685 D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*File,
692 LinkageName, File, LineNo, Ty, isLocalToUnit, isDefinition,
703 D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*File,
709 LinkageName, Fil
579 createGlobalVariable( D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*F, unsigned LineNumber, DIType *Ty, bool isLocalToUnit, Constant *Val, MDNode *Decl) argument
593 createTempGlobalVariableFwdDecl( D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*F, unsigned LineNumber, DIType *Ty, bool isLocalToUnit, Constant *Val, MDNode *Decl) argument
664 createFunction( DIScopeRef Context, StringRef Name, StringRef LinkageName, DIFile *File, unsigned LineNo, DISubroutineType *Ty, bool isLocalToUnit, bool isDefinition, unsigned ScopeLine, unsigned Flags, bool isOptimized, DITemplateParameterArray TParams, DISubprogram *Decl) argument
684 createFunction( D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*File, unsigned LineNo, DISubroutineType *Ty, bool isLocalToUnit, bool isDefinition, unsigned ScopeLine, unsigned Flags, bool isOptimized, DITemplateParameterArray TParams, DISubprogram *Decl) argument
702 createTempFunctionFwdDecl( D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*File, unsigned LineNo, DISubroutineType *Ty, bool isLocalToUnit, bool isDefinition, unsigned ScopeLine, unsigned Flags, bool isOptimized, DITemplateParameterArray TParams, DISubprogram *Decl) argument
716 createMethod(DIScope *Context, StringRef Name, StringRef LinkageName, DIFile *F, unsigned LineNo, DISubroutineType *Ty, bool isLocalToUnit, bool isDefinition, unsigned VK, unsigned VIndex, DIType *VTableHolder, unsigned Flags, bool isOptimized, DITemplateParameterArray TParams) argument
[all...]
H A DDebugInfoMetadata.cpp342 MDString *LinkageName, Metadata *File, unsigned Line, Metadata *Type,
349 assert(isCanonical(LinkageName) && "Expected canonical MDString");
351 (Scope, getString(Name), getString(LinkageName), File,
356 LinkageName, Type, ContainingType, TemplateParams,
442 MDString *LinkageName, Metadata *File, unsigned Line,
448 assert(isCanonical(LinkageName) && "Expected canonical MDString");
450 (Scope, getString(Name), getString(LinkageName), File,
454 Name, LinkageName, Variable, StaticDataMemberDeclaration};
340 getImpl( LLVMContext &Context, Metadata *Scope, MDString *Name, MDString *LinkageName, Metadata *File, unsigned Line, Metadata *Type, bool IsLocalToUnit, bool IsDefinition, unsigned ScopeLine, Metadata *ContainingType, unsigned Virtuality, unsigned VirtualIndex, unsigned Flags, bool IsOptimized, Metadata *TemplateParams, Metadata *Declaration, Metadata *Variables, StorageType Storage, bool ShouldCreate) argument
441 getImpl(LLVMContext &Context, Metadata *Scope, MDString *Name, MDString *LinkageName, Metadata *File, unsigned Line, Metadata *Type, bool IsLocalToUnit, bool IsDefinition, Metadata *Variable, Metadata *StaticDataMemberDeclaration, StorageType Storage, bool ShouldCreate) argument
/external/llvm/include/llvm/DebugInfo/Symbolize/
H A DSymbolize.h38 Options(FunctionNameKind PrintFunctions = FunctionNameKind::LinkageName,
/external/llvm/lib/DebugInfo/PDB/
H A DPDBContext.cpp98 if (NameKind == DINameKind::LinkageName) {
/external/llvm/unittests/IR/
H A DMetadataTest.cpp1408 StringRef LinkageName = "linkage"; local
1425 Context, Scope, Name, LinkageName, File, Line, Type, IsLocalToUnit,
1432 EXPECT_EQ(LinkageName, N->getLinkageName());
1447 EXPECT_EQ(N, DISubprogram::get(Context, Scope, Name, LinkageName, File, Line,
1453 EXPECT_NE(N, DISubprogram::get(Context, getCompositeType(), Name, LinkageName,
1458 EXPECT_NE(N, DISubprogram::get(Context, Scope, "other", LinkageName, File,
1468 EXPECT_NE(N, DISubprogram::get(Context, Scope, Name, LinkageName, getFile(),
1473 EXPECT_NE(N, DISubprogram::get(Context, Scope, Name, LinkageName, File,
1478 EXPECT_NE(N, DISubprogram::get(Context, Scope, Name, LinkageName, File, Line,
1483 EXPECT_NE(N, DISubprogram::get(Context, Scope, Name, LinkageName, Fil
1737 StringRef LinkageName = "linkage"; local
[all...]
/external/llvm/bindings/go/llvm/
H A DDIBuilderBindings.h56 const char *LinkageName, LLVMMetadataRef File, unsigned Line,
H A DDIBuilderBindings.cpp75 const char *LinkageName, LLVMMetadataRef File, unsigned Line,
79 return wrap(D->createFunction(unwrap<DIScope>(Scope), Name, LinkageName,
73 LLVMDIBuilderCreateFunction( LLVMDIBuilderRef Dref, LLVMMetadataRef Scope, const char *Name, const char *LinkageName, LLVMMetadataRef File, unsigned Line, LLVMMetadataRef CompositeType, int IsLocalToUnit, int IsDefinition, unsigned ScopeLine, unsigned Flags, int IsOptimized) argument
/external/llvm/include/llvm/DebugInfo/
H A DDIContext.h83 enum class DINameKind { None, ShortName, LinkageName };
/external/clang/lib/CodeGen/
H A DCGDebugInfo.cpp2411 StringRef &LinkageName,
2419 LinkageName = CGM.getMangledName(GD);
2425 if (LinkageName == Name ||
2429 LinkageName = StringRef();
2447 StringRef &Name, StringRef &LinkageName,
2467 LinkageName = CGM.getMangledName(VD);
2468 if (LinkageName == Name)
2469 LinkageName = StringRef();
2495 StringRef Name, LinkageName; local
2502 collectFunctionDeclProps(FD, Unit, Name, LinkageName, DContex
2409 collectFunctionDeclProps(GlobalDecl GD, llvm::DIFile *Unit, StringRef &Name, StringRef &LinkageName, llvm::DIScope *&FDContext, llvm::DINodeArray &TParamsArray, unsigned &Flags) argument
2445 collectVarDeclProps(const VarDecl *VD, llvm::DIFile *&Unit, unsigned &LineNo, QualType &T, StringRef &Name, StringRef &LinkageName, llvm::DIScope *&VDContext) argument
2526 StringRef Name, LinkageName; local
2672 StringRef LinkageName; local
2746 StringRef LinkageName; local
3312 CollectAnonRecordDecls( const RecordDecl *RD, llvm::DIFile *Unit, unsigned LineNo, StringRef LinkageName, llvm::GlobalVariable *Var, llvm::DIScope *DContext) argument
3344 StringRef DeclName, LinkageName; local
[all...]
H A DCGDebugInfo.h471 unsigned LineNo, StringRef LinkageName,
505 StringRef &Name, StringRef &LinkageName,
513 StringRef &LinkageName, llvm::DIScope *&VDContext);
/external/llvm/tools/llvm-readobj/
H A DCOFFDumper.cpp543 StringRef LinkageName; local
545 LinkageName));
546 W.printString("LinkageName", LinkageName);
547 if (FunctionLineTables.count(LinkageName) != 0) {
553 FunctionLineTables[LinkageName] = Contents;
554 FunctionNames.push_back(LinkageName);
591 W.printString("LinkageName", Name);
/external/llvm/lib/DebugInfo/DWARF/
H A DDWARFDebugInfoEntry.cpp170 if (const char *Name = DIE.getName(RefU, DINameKind::LinkageName))
390 if (Kind == DINameKind::LinkageName) {
/external/llvm/lib/DebugInfo/Symbolize/
H A DSymbolizableObjectFile.cpp196 return FNKind == FunctionNameKind::LinkageName && UseSymbolTable &&
/external/llvm/lib/CodeGen/AsmPrinter/
H A DDwarfUnit.cpp669 void DwarfUnit::addLinkageName(DIE &Die, StringRef LinkageName) { argument
670 if (!LinkageName.empty() && DD->useLinkageNames())
674 GlobalValue::getRealLinkageName(LinkageName));
1170 StringRef LinkageName = SP->getLinkageName(); local
1171 assert(((LinkageName.empty() || DeclLinkageName.empty()) ||
1172 LinkageName == DeclLinkageName) &&
1175 addLinkageName(SPDie, LinkageName);
H A DDwarfUnit.h257 void addLinkageName(DIE &Die, StringRef LinkageName);
/external/llvm/tools/dsymutil/
H A DDwarfLinker.cpp1580 const char *Name = DIE->getName(&U.getOrigUnit(), DINameKind::LinkageName);
1714 (Info.MangledName = Die.getName(&U, DINameKind::LinkageName)))

Completed in 962 milliseconds